Who can join

18 and older, any sex, with Multi-drug Resistant Tuberculosis or Extensively Drug-Resistant Tuberculosis.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.

Sponsor's own description

PRACTECAL-PKPD is an exploratory p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amic sub-study investigating the relationship between the patients' exposure to anti- tuberculosis (TB) drugs in the TB-PRACTECAL trial investigational regimens and their respective treatment outcomes.
